The U.S. & Canada Water and Wastewater Pipe Forecasts dashboard provides 10-year forecasts for municipal pipe investment across North America. Users can analyze projected CAPEX by geography, water type, project type, material, and pipe diameter, while comparing results across Baseline, Lower Limit, and Upper Limit forecast scenarios. The dashboard delivers a flexible view of future pipe demand, helping users evaluate regional investment opportunities and understand how changing market conditions could influence spending.

How does the pipe & sewer data differ from Bluefield’s treatment CAPEX data?

Bluefield’s Pipe & Sewer Forecasts focus on underground infrastructure, detailing capital spend by pipe material, diameter, and project type. In contrast, the Treatment Infrastructure CAPEX data tracks above-ground investment in treatment facilities, with breakdowns by equipment category, water type, and utility size.
